Severity index 92.0 - Medium. This weights crashes, fires, injuries and fatalities per 100 complaints; see methodology.

Among the 123 2019 vehicles we track with at least 40 complaints on file, the 2019 Nissan Altima ranks 22 of 123 by severity, where 1 is the worst. Its severity is higher than 82% of its model-year peers. See the full 2019 ranking.

The single most-reported system is ELECTRICAL SYSTEM, cited in 57 of 224 complaints (25.4%). One complaint can name several systems, so these shares overlap and do not total 100%.

21V16900011/03/2021TIRESNiss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ain 2019-2020 Altima and 2018-2021 Titan vehicles equipped with Continental tires. On the affected vehicles, it is possible that one or more tires were cured for too long during tire production.
19V31600018/04/2019FUEL SYSTEM, GASOLINE:DELIVERY:FUEL PUMPNiss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ain 2019 Altima vehicles equipped with front wheel drive (FWD) and 2.5 liter engines. 18V92200020/12/2018FUEL SYSTEM, GASOLINE:DELIVERY:FUEL PUMPNissan North America, Inc (Nissan) is recalling certain 2019 Altima vehicles. The retainer clip connecting the low pressure fuel tube to the high pressure fuel pump may not have been locked into position.
19V23500025/03/2019EXTERIOR LIGHTING:BRAKE LIGHTS:SWITCHNiss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ain 2019 Nissan Altima vehicles. The brake switch bracket may be in the incorrect location, which may cause the brake switch to remain on.

Complaints are unverified consumer reports; volume is influenced by how many units were sold and how long the vehicle has been on the road. Not affiliated with NHTSA or any manufacturer.
